래더 로직

위키백과, 우리 모두의 백과사전.

래더 로직(Ladder logic) 또는 래더 프로그래밍(Ladder programming)은 원래 공장 및 산업에서 전기 및 기계을 사용하는 제조 및 공정 제어에 사용되는 릴레이 랙의 설계 및 구성을 문서화하는 서면 방법이었다. 이것은 릴레이 랙의 각 장치가 표시된 다이어그램 사이에 연결되어있는 래더 다이어그램(Ladder Diagram,LD)의 기호로 표시된다. 이후 발전하여 래더 로직(Ladder logic)은 이러한 LD를 심볼과 기호의 그래픽적 처리를 통해서 프로그래밍을 할 수 있는 것을 가리킨다. 그러나 여전히 명령어 리스트(instruction list)인 니모닉(Mnemonic) 수준에서 어셈블리언어의 텍스트에 기반 및 호환된다.

래더 프로그래밍[편집]

특히 래더 프로그래밍은 프로그래머블 로직 컨트롤러(PLC)프로그래밍의 주요한 언어중 하나이다.

니모닉[편집]

니모닉(mnemonic)은 컴퓨터과학에서 인간이 기억하기 쉬운 형태로 이름을 나타내는 기호를 가리킨다. 예를 들어, 어셈블리 언어에서 더하기를 나타내는 애드(ADD)나 곱하기를 나타내는 멀(MUL) 따위의 명령 코드를 이른다. 니모닉 코드라고도 한다.

같이 보기[편집]

참고[편집]